Transaction cd8db0eed8a2e5086ad3dd6e58951128928f7c4192d69c4689d14b2bfe57c9e6
3 Input
2 Outputs
- cd8db0eed8a2e5086ad3dd6e58951128928f7c4192d69c4689d14b2bfe57c9e6:0
- cd8db0eed8a2e5086ad3dd6e58951128928f7c4192d69c4689d14b2bfe57c9e6:1
value 658907
address 16FoE2f2hhdUNMB3VMDhpAu1RTBtLbvZLC
value 2129685
address 3GrAD9SBwMjVnDaha1VsbwrJBmEjdEADLR